6 Niches defined by how obtain food Niches defined by how obtain food Autotrophs (Producers): Autotrophs (Producers): Make own food (grass) Make own food (grass) Heterotrophs (Consumers): Heterotrophs (Consumers): Herbivores: Eat plants (grasshopper) Herbivores: Eat plants (grasshopper)grasshopper Carnivores: Eat animals (snake) Carnivores: Eat animals (snake)snake Omnivores: Eat plants and animals (humans) Omnivores: Eat plants and animals (humans) Scavengers: Eat dead things; life’s clean-up crew! (vultures) Scavengers: Eat dead things; life’s clean-up crew! (vultures) Decomposers: life’s recyclers (bacteria and fungi) Decomposers: life’s recyclers (bacteria and fungi)bacteria and fungibacteria and fungi

7 What are the relationships in an ecosystem? Symbiotic relationships Symbiotic relationships When orgs live in REALLY close quarters When orgs live in REALLY close quarters Parasitism: Parasitism: Live off other orgs but don’t kill them (some worms, ticks, fleas) Live off other orgs but don’t kill them (some worms, ticks, fleas) Mutualism: Mutualism: Orgs that both benefit (Clownfish and sea anemone) Orgs that both benefit (Clownfish and sea anemone) Commensalism: Commensalism: One org benefits, other neither harmed or benefitted (Whale and barnacles) One org benefits, other neither harmed or benefitted (Whale and barnacles)

10 What happens to energy in an ecosystem? Every organism uses energy to carry out life processes Every organism uses energy to carry out life processes If an organism is eaten, it will give less energy to the predator If an organism is eaten, it will give less energy to the predator THEREFORE, ENERGY DECREASES AS YOU MOVE UP A FOOD CHAIN! THEREFORE, ENERGY DECREASES AS YOU MOVE UP A FOOD CHAIN! WE USE AN ENERGY PYRAMID TO SHOW THIS! WE USE AN ENERGY PYRAMID TO SHOW THIS!
